#151a4c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#151a4c is composed of 8.2% red, 10.2% green and 29.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 72.4% cyan, 65.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 70.2% black. It has a hue angle of 234.5 degrees, a saturation of 56.7% and a lightness of 19%. #151a4c color hex could be obtained by blending #2a3498 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003333.

#151a4c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#151a4c has RGB values of R:21, G:26, B:76 and CMYK values of C:0.72, M:0.66, Y:0, K:0.7. Its decimal value is 1382988.
